Dive into the Spectacular Future Weekend at Halle Saline Museum – June 14, 2025!

Get ready to immerse yourself in the thrilling "Future to Touch: Halle Unveiled" event happening at the Halle Saline Museum on June 14, 2025, from 10 am till 5 pm. No need to empty your pockets, as admission is absolutely free!

Get a sneak peek of 24 top-notch models and plans exhibited by the Federal Office for Building and Regional Planning (BBR). The showcase includes the winning design by the Berlin planning team, Richter Musikowski Architects and ST Raum Landschaftsarchitektur, and 102 other brilliant architectural submissions.

Coinciding with this exhibition, the exceptional transformation of the Saline Museum through complete renovation will be displayed in an additional exhibition at the Großsiedehalle Nord. Join guided tours at 12, 2, and 4 pm to delve deeper into the fascinating transformation process.

The exhibition of competition entries for the Future Center will be open from Wednesday through Sunday till July 13, 2025, in the Großsiedehalle Süd of the Saline Museum. Admission remains free throughout its run.

Kick off the day with Halle's Mayor Dr. Alexander Vogt as he officially opens the event at 11 am. At 1 and 3 pm, specialized experts will gladly answer any questions you might have about the Future Center and the renovation of the Riebeckplatz.

Join interactive workshops, provocative debates, and engaging activities – all designed to explore the future of construction, smart city solutions, and scientific research. Take part in AI workshops on building the construction sites of the future (1 and 3 pm), test your building skills by attempting to construct a Leonardo bridge, or try the Rivercheck: How clean is the Saale.

Discover the wonders of Halle's transformation over the ages under the theme "The Place with the Five Names," showcasing historical images from the city archive. Witness the current state and future appearances of the Riebeckplatz and the RAW area in dynamic 3D models and short films, created by the Halle-Saalkreis Development and Administration Company (EVG). A cyber-savvy future awaits us by 2038 as envisioned in the form of a Cyber Quarter, which will offer spaces for living, research, and work in the neighborhood of the Future Center and the main station.

Don't miss the science2public-led tours over the new Elisabeth bridge at 11:30 am and 3:30 pm, or grab a seat in the Smart City Mobile digital café to ask all your burning questions about smartphones and app usage.
